Transaction 7843be848993394cd85df25efdaf27616a3ae041895ee1b9959fa7e0ad1d6780

41 Input
2 Outputs
  • 7843be848993394cd85df25efdaf27616a3ae041895ee1b9959fa7e0ad1d6780:0
  • value  65653440
    address  1LccbXwjbeco58QXXu7mfKtkEEpSwMDZPQ
  • 7843be848993394cd85df25efdaf27616a3ae041895ee1b9959fa7e0ad1d6780:1
  • value  119198
    address  bc1qycu88g6z77sqs6frwfmkg0ygeapngd3pm7rsvg